Does Diablo support cross-save between Steam and Blizzard Client?
Like there is a free trial on Battlenet right now i wanna try it and buy it on Steam later

Yes. I switched over from the Blizzard Client and picked up where I left off.

Yes, as long as you use your Blizzard account on both versions, the progress will transfer across.

Yes, I played the trial on Bnet and bought it on Steam. My character was still there.
